You Suck: A Love Story, by Christopher Moore (2007)

This was pretty good. 19 year old Tommy sleeps with his hot vampire girlfriend Jody and becomes a vampire himself. Lots of vampire feeding/sex/hiding adventures in San Francisco, including those with "assistant" 16 year old Goth girl, a giant shaved cat, etc. This was a sequel and I didn't read earlier book. Maybe I've had enough Christopher Moore for awhile. I'll say 3 1/2 stars. 

Here's Publisher's Weekely review:

Moore's latest (after 2006's A Dirty Job) is a cheerfully perverse, gut-busting tale of young vampires in love. Nineteen-year-old Tommy is a bewildered hipster recently relocated to San Francisco from Incontinence, Ind. His sarcastic redhead (and bloodsucking) girlfriend, Jody, brings him into the fold of the undead ("I wanted us to be together," she says). Tommy, understandably, has mixed feelings; vampirism has its perks (you can turn to mist, live forever and the sex is awesome), but sunlight is death and blood hunger makes you do some pretty foul things. Also, the duo is hunted by Elijah, the ancient vampire who "turned" Jody and wants her back, and a band of Safeway stock boys/amateur vampire hunters known as the Animals (with whom pre–dark side Tommy once rolled). With the assistance of their devoted minion, goth girl Abby Normal, whose hilarious diary entries form part of the narrative, Tommy and Jody evade their pursuers, feeding at night and conking out at dawn, all the while learning how vampirism complicates love.
